Output 126998bb089b4664e85972773a18579ac6d05de2119e6c0640709b8dc87ad614:0

value
10810634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b1525d5878b9db59de103aa1a9733d66a288d6 OP_EQUAL
address
3CRKQX1RBfMQ1ojjNgmupUc8m57R95k18p
transaction
126998bb089b4664e85972773a18579ac6d05de2119e6c0640709b8dc87ad614
confirmations
496618
spent
true